Japanese firms interested in broadening co-op with Azerbaijan on seismology

30 July 2013 [10:03] - TODAY.AZ
Leading Japanese companies dealing with seismology and engineering seismology have expressed their keenness to further expand relationship with Azerbaijan.

In a meeting with Gurban Yetirmishli, Director General of Republican Seismic Survey Center of Azerbaijan National Academy of Sciences (RCSS ANAS), Japanese experts Ryo Amano, manager of “Shinyei Kaisha”, and Masakazu Takahashi of “OYO International Corporation”, stressed the importance of boosting the bilateral cooperation.

The sides discussed ways how to expand relations, and conduct exchange of experience.

Yetirmishli highlighted the activities and international cooperation of RCSS, saying Azerbaijan was effectively cooperating with Japanese companies.

The Japanese experts praised work done by the Azerbaijani government in the field of seismology.

The experts also visited RCSS`s monitoring center.
